Senior Storage Infrastructure Architect supporting a large-scale storage modernization initiative within a regulated environment in Canada. Engaging with stakeholders to guide architectural decisions.
Responsibilities
Support a large-scale storage modernization and data migration initiative within a regulated enterprise environment
Perform structured current-state assessments of enterprise storage and data protection environments, with emphasis on Dell ECS, Dell Data Domain, and Dell NetWorker platforms
Identify architectural constraints, dependencies, and risk factors associated with large-scale data storage and migration in regulated environments
Define target-state storage and data protection architectures aligned with scalability, resiliency, compliance, and performance requirements
Develop migration strategies for petabyte-scale data sets, including sequencing, validation, cutover, and rollback considerations
Produce and maintain architectural artifacts, including logical designs, high-level physical designs, and migration approach documentation
Provide technical governance and architectural oversight to internal and client implementation teams executing the migration
Review and validate implementation designs and plans for alignment with the approved architecture
Participate in technical deliberations, design reviews, and risk discussions with client stakeholders
Act as a senior technical advisor and escalation point for architecture-related decisions throughout the engagement
Requirements
Senior-level background in storage infrastructure architecture within large, complex enterprise environments
Architectural ownership of solutions based on Dell ECS and Dell Data Domain platforms
Leadership of large-scale on-premises to cloud or hybrid storage migration initiatives
Exposure to regulated environments with associated compliance, risk, and governance considerations
Deep understanding of enterprise backup and data protection architectures, including Dell NetWorker
Track record of architectural risk assessment and definition of appropriate mitigation strategies
Demonstrated ability to communicate and defend architectural decisions with both technical and non-technical stakeholders in enterprise environments
Operation in a consulting or advisory capacity as well as guiding delivery teams
